after going to the 35's i'm noticing alot of shimmy when hitting bumps and especially when taking turns. front end is tight, hubs are good, just had it aligned when i got the new wheels. when i had it aligned my caster read 4.8 and 4.9. i'm wondering if more caster will help with this or am i chasing the wrong thing? considering getting the wheels balanced again. also i have adjustable arms all around
 
Bump steer is almost always caused by aftermarket parts that affect the steering or track bar. Do you have pics/any info on what you have installed on steering or font track bar? That caster is just fine - and would only really affect the jeeps ability to return to center.

What symptom exactly are you calling bump steer? Bump steer is caused by a steering geometry problem that forces the steering left/right as the axle moves up/down over bump/dips in the road.

Your 4.8/4.9 caster angle is a bit light for 35's, 5.5 would be better and make your Jeep track better. The only way to increase it however is via either adjustable length control arms up front or adjustable ball joints.

Shimmy when hitting bumps could be caused by something loose. Do this... with the tires on the ground, have a helper repeatedly make quick left/right turns with the steering wheel while you closely look at the front-end steering components for side-to-side slop or unusual movement seen at the tie rod ends, track bar mounting points, drag link mounts, or ball joints. Keep in mind that the tie rod and drag link are both mounted on ball joints so rotational slop/movement you'd feel by grabbing either and rotating them back & forth around their long axis is normal.
 
@Jerry Bransford that was the first thing i diagnosed having my buddy back and forth the steering and everything seemed tight no play, to make sure i torqued everything to spec in the front. thinking its a tire balance issue. i would like to get the caster adjusted, is it possible to adjust caster without having to get it aligned again ?

Put an angle finder on the flat machined spots on the front of the differential. Shorten the upper control arms to add angle. You know the starting caster so just add a degree to the measurement off of the front of the housing. It will affect axle positioning slightly, but probably not enough to be concerned with extending the lowers.

After you're done, verify that the angle between the front driveshaft and the pinion is not excessive. Ideally it needs to be 3° or less.
